ABOUT THE PATTERN
DIFFICULTY: Medium
Blouse with a classic fit, three-quarter sleeves, and detailed edges.
The Rosemary Blouse is knitted top-down. First, the neckline is shaped with short rows, while raglan increases are made.
The edges along the body and sleeves are finished with a delicate pattern consisting of knit and purl stitches.
FIT
The measurements given are the finished measurements of the blouse. It is designed to have a positive ease of 10 cm. Example: if your bust measurement is 97 cm + 10 cm = 112 cm, then you should knit a size L.

MATERIALS NEEDED:
SUGGESTED NEEDLES 5 mm 40/60/80 cm for body and sleeves & 4.5 mm 60 cm for collar
YARN CONSUMPTION 350, 400, 450, 500, 550, 600 grams Nepal from Drops, 65% Peruvian Highland Wool, 35% Superfine Alpaca, 50 g = approx. 75 meters
or the same amount of leftover yarn – the quantity is an estimate and will vary depending on the type of yarn you use.
GAUGE 16 stitches in stockinette stitch on 5 mm needles = 10 cm
SIZES XS (S) M (L) XL (XXL)
FINISHED MEASUREMENTS
Bust circumference: 99 (104) 109 (114) 120 (125) cm
Length: Measured From Cast-On Edge At Neck: 51 (52) 53 (54) 55 (56) Cm
